Damicor are recruiting for Qualified Electricians at Stansted Airport! You will be working on the Airport Lounge Refurbishment project (strip out, first & second fix, containment etc).

Key Information

  • Location: Stansted Airport
  • Hourly Rate: £27 per hour, via CIS
  • Hours: Paid 9.5
  • Start & Finish Time: 7am - 4:30pm
  • Length: 12 months
  • Parking: Free Parking

Requirements

  • Due to the environment applicants must hold the following to be considered:
  • Compliant to live and work in the UK
  • Willing to obtain an Airside Pass
  • Willing to apply for a DBS Check
  • JIB/ECS Gold Card
  • IPAF 3a & 3b
